Rowdy Rooster brings a lively fusion of Indian spices and classic American comfort food to New York. Guests rave about the massive hot chicken sandwiches layered with vibrant mango lime sauces and the exceptional vada pav served with refreshing mango lassi. The ambiance is an energetic rooster extravaganza, creating a warm museum-like atmosphere that welcomes solo diners and families alike. With fast service, extensive delivery options, and a fully accessible entrance, this affordable spot offers juicy, crispy chicken seasoned with unique global influences. Whether enjoying a quick lunch or a late-night dinner, the team's attentive hospitality ensures every meal is an unforgettable culinary adventure.

Rowdy Rooster serves Indian-style fried chicken that many customers find flavorful and unique. The Big Rowdy Combo, chicken sandwiches, and Masala Fries are popular. Spice levels can vary, so some suggest going beyond the mildest option. Some found it a bit pricey.
